Seamus Luis-Earle)RevOps is a brand new concept for most. RevOps is the unification of all functions to prioritize revenue as the primary objective. It’s the toppling of silos that divide a company and keep teams from working together effectively. The goal is to implement cross-divisional ops, data practices, and a collaborative framework enabling marketing, sales, CS, product, and finance to work together.--- Send in a voice message: https://anchor.fm/dtrhpodcast/messageSupport this podcast: https://anchor.fm/dtrhpodcast/support2022-05-1253 minDown the Rabbit HoleDown the Rabbit HoleThe Tales of a Sales Sage (Ft. Justin Michael)What is a "Salesborg," you may ask? A "Salesborg" is a human-machine combo, like a cyborg, but in the context of an incredibly tech-proficient individual working in harmony with software and automation to optimize selling and outreach. The future of sales and marketing lies in the hands of salespeople who leverage technology to maximize performance and output.--- Send in a voice message: https://anchor.fm/dtrhpodcast/messageSupport this podcast: https://anchor.fm/dtrhpodcast/support2021-06-1050 minDown the Rabbit HoleDown the Rabbit HoleWhy Cold-Calling Isn't Dead (Ft.
